A traumatic brain injury (TBI) occurs from a blow, jolt or bump to the head that disrupts the normal function of the brain. This can happen when the head hits an object without warning or if an object makes contact to the head - in some cases piercing through the skull and damaging brain tissue.

When a person experiences head trauma, it's important to seek treatment as soon as possible. Traumatic Brain Injury Symptoms 

Although not all blows or bumps to the head will result in a TBI, a traumatic brain injury can range from mild to severe. The majority of TBIs that can occur on an annual basis are concussions, however even a mild concussion can lead to serious injury if it is not treated or a if secondary concussion occurs before the first one heals properly.

A person who has sustained a traumatic brain injury can experience a variety of symptoms that include:
 
  • loss of consciousness;
  • headache;
  • nausea;
  • dizziness;
  • blurred vision;
  • fatigue;
  • inability to recollect memories;
  • lack of concentration;
  • numbness;
  • loss of coordination; and
  • behavioral and mood changes. 


Getting immediate medical treatment can help save a life or reduce the potential long-term effects of a traumatic brain injury.
